    Last night we switched our default machine type from Amazon's c1.medium (2 core) instances, to x1.large.

    The new machines are featuring 8 cores, 7 GB memory, better I/O performance and 64 bit architecture.

    If you are performing assemblies that are heavy on encoding, especially those involving multiple output formats, you should see a significant boost in encoding speed.

    Unless something comes up, our plan is to only use 8 core machines in production going forward. And who knows, the Cluster Compute Instances (cc1.4xlarge) are only one step away now : ).
